Output 81c40907ac3faadb90ea4e511f2f99d05d4b9243716e38afa365868960b98ab5:1765

value
3669
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0612fbedde453c90fba0e5794dff5d694333b520e9a23b587ca523d2921bc3a1
address
bc1pqcf0hmw7g57fp7aqu4u5ml6ad9pn8dfqax3rkkru553a9ysmcwssp8ven9
transaction
81c40907ac3faadb90ea4e511f2f99d05d4b9243716e38afa365868960b98ab5
spent
true